Keys

The keys that we use in cars today have evolved from simple pieces of metal that were carved into laser-cut keys with embedded smart chips. The latest technology has made them safer than ever before, but they're not a guarantee. When it's time to replace them, you need the help of professional locksmith. These experts have the tools and equipment required to make new keys on the spot without causing damage to your vehicle. They can also repair and replace locks, even when they're inoperable.

The top edge of the key features a series of V-shaped valleys. Each valley represents a distinct depth, and the combination of all valleys is a code that corresponds to the pins on the cylinder. The key is being able to turn the cylinder if all the valleys are in the correct sequence of depths.

If you've never picked an lock before, it may be difficult to understand how it operates. Once you've grasped the fundamentals it's a breeze. You need to first find the key's warding design. This is a type of design that limits which keys can be used in the lock's keyway. The stop is typically situated in the middle of the blade, however, on certain keys the tip is utilized instead.

Whenever you insert the key into the lock it causes the pins to move upwards and down. If you insert the right key, the pins align with the shearline. If the shear line is unblock the cylinder will rotate and unlock the lock. If the shear line is blocked, the cylinder won't turn, and you'll need to try again using a different key.

Transponders

The term "transponder" is an acronym that comes from the words transmitter and responder is used to refer to devices that transmit or receive wireless signals to monitor communications, control, or monitoring. They are typically found in automobiles, aircrafts, https://futurelaw.io and other vehicles, as they are also used in satellites to relay communications signals. Transponders are divided into two categories: passive and Active. Transponders that transmit radio signals which can be monitored. They also come with batteries that provide power to the device. Active transponders emit signals that can be detected by the receiver, but they are much more powerful than passive transponders. Due to this, they require more power and are usually connected to batteries to last longer.

A microchip, also known as a transponder, is a device that transmits signals to an antenna. Its function is to identify individuals or objects. it works by absorbing electromagnetic signals and responding to it by generating a unique code. The code is then read by the antenna that is receiving it. Transponders are a standard feature of automobiles, and they can help prevent theft by providing a secure method to start the vehicle.

Many cars have a transponder key that makes use of an induction coil to transmit a signal to the vehicle's receiver. When the transponder key is placed into the ignition, the receiver receives a signal and reads an identification code from the transponder. The engine will begin if the number is in line with the serial number of the car. Additionally, some vehicles have an immobilizer that prevents the engine from starting without an active transponder.

Key fobs

Key fobs today do so more than unlock and start your car. They also serve as a tool for convenience and are a useful anti-theft device. But despite their many advantages they can be difficult to use. And when they malfunction, you need a locksmith to help.

Unlike the traditional metal keys that were the basis for cars for the better part of a century modern fobs come with a tiny chip inside that communicates with a transponder in your vehicle's dashboard. The chip creates an unique code that is transmitted to the car's computer each time you use your key fob. This helps prevent thieves from stealing your key's unique signal by using a device which is able to intercept and repeat the signals. This technology does not secure your car from hackers. Some people are still capable of capturing and retransmitting your key fob's signal to their receivers, which could unlock your car's doors and even start the engine.

It is important to know that a dealer can only program an additional key fob if you provide the VIN of your vehicle as well as proof of ownership. If you're trying to save money, online dealers will ship you pre-programmed fobs. Be sure to read reviews and only buy from reliable sellers.

Batteries can also fail. The majority of automakers make replacing batteries relatively simple. You can purchase replacement batteries at the hardware store or a big-box retailers, and your owner's manual should contain instructions on how to install it.
